
About this product
A cleansing balm with a grind-style mechanism designed to remove makeup and impurities, formulated for all skin types.

What the gurus are saying
The grind-style packaging stands out for letting you portion out exactly what you need each time, a detail reviewers consistently praise for control and preventing wastage. They found it leaves skin feeling nicely moisturized and works well for all skin types, with appealing fruity ingredients like cranberry and wild strawberry. The overall formulation draws people back for repeated use.

Full ingredients
Caprylic/Capric Triglyceride, C13-15 Alkane, PEG-20 Glyceryl Triisostearate, Synthetic Wax, Ricinus Communis (Castor) Seed Oil, Helianthus Annuus (Sunflower) Seed Oil, Polysorbate 85, Silica Dimethyl Silylate, 1,2-Hexanediol, Vaccinium Macrocarpon (Cranberry) Fruit Powder, Trihydroxystearin, Tocopheryl Acetate, Lithospermum Erythrorhizon Root Extract, Zea Mays (Corn) Germ Oil, Pentaerythrityl Tetra-Di-T-Butyl Hydroxyhydrocinnamate, Ribes Nigrum (Black Currant) Fruit Extract, Punica Granatum Fruit Extract, Water, Butylene Glycol, Hippophae Rhamnoides Fruit Extract, Fragaria Vesca (Strawberry) Fruit Extract, Malpighia Emarginata (Acerola) Fruit Extract, Terminalia Ferdinandiana Fruit Extract, Euterpe Oleracea Fruit Extract
